What is a 3 Wheel Pram?
A 3 wheel pram, also known as a three-wheeled Stroller 3 Wheels, features a single wheel at the front and two larger wheels at the back. This triangular structure not just supplies a distinct look however also provides a variety of functional advantages. Their design usually provides itself to improved maneuverability and stability, making them a popular option among parents who are typically on the go.
Advantages of 3 Wheel Prams
There are several reasons that moms and dads might choose a 3 wheel pram over standard four-wheeled models:
Maneuverability: The design allows for much easier navigation through tight spaces, making them great for city environments or crowded locations.
Stability: The two rear wheels create a strong base, while the single front wheel typically has swivel functionality, allowing for sharp turns without jeopardizing on balance.
Off-Road Capability: Many 3 Wheeler Buggy wheel prams have bigger, air-filled tires that can manage different surfaces, from rough sidewalks to park tracks, providing a daring choice for active families.
Lightweight Design: Generally, 3 wheel prams tend to be lighter than their four-wheeled equivalents, permitting easier lifting and transportation.
Adjustable Features: Many designs come equipped with adjustable handles, reclining seats, and sufficient storage space, accommodating diverse consumer requirements.
Things to Consider
While 3 wheel prams have numerous advantages, it's important for parents to think about a couple of aspects before buying:
Weight: Although lots of designs are lightweight, some can be much heavier than expected, especially when packed with a child and extra accessories.
Stability Issues: For newborns or smaller children, some moms and dads may find that a 3 wheel pram is less stable if the kid is seated toward the front.
Price Range: With numerous models available, the prices can vary significantly. Budget-conscious parents will wish to find a pram that caters to their needs without breaking the bank.
Foldability and Storage: It's important to examine how easily the pram folds for transport and storage, especially for families with restricted area.

Are 3 wheel prams safe for babies?
Yes, lots of 3 wheel prams are designed with safety in mind and come geared up with features such as five-point harnesses and adjustable recline settings. Nevertheless, it's important to make sure the model you choose appropriates for babies, as some and may have a weight limitation.
2. What surface can I use a 3 wheel pram on?
3 wheel prams are flexible and can frequently manage different terrains, consisting of pavement, park trails, lawn, and gravel. Those with bigger, air-filled tires are particularly fit for off-road conditions.
3. How easy is it to fold and keep a 3 wheel pram?
Most modern-day 3 wheel prams include instinctive folding mechanisms, permitting simple storage and transport. Nevertheless, the simplicity of folding can differ by design, so it's smart to check this out in-store before acquiring.
4. Can you attach an automobile seat to a 3 wheel pram?
Many 3 wheel prams are suitable with car seat adapters, permitting you to create a travel system. However, always inspect the specifics of the design you are thinking about to ensure it meets your needs.
5. What is the cost range for 3 wheel prams?
Rate can differ commonly based upon brand, functions, and resilience. Typically, you can anticipate to find reputable models varying from ₤ 200 to ₤ 600.
